The most popular Motability scooters are mobility scooters in class 3. They are specifically designed for those who require an extra-long range and greater comfort for their everyday travel. They meet British government requirements and can be driven on the roads, bus lanes, or lanes that are 'cycle-only' however, it is not recommended to drive them on unrestricted dual carriageways. They are usually driven at the speed of eight miles per hour, which makes them safe to use on the road. They are equipped with a robust braking and a robust brake system, as well as rear and front lights, reflectors, and direction indicators and rear view mirrors as well as a Horn. If you intend to travel for long distances on your scooter, a battery that can last for up to 30 miles is necessary. This allows you to take road trips and other outdoor activities without worrying about the battery's lifespan. To prolong the life of your battery, it is important to charge it frequently and avoid overcharging. To extend the life of your mobility scooter, opt for one with a rechargeable lithium-ion battery. Lithium-ion batteries are more efficient than traditional nickel metal Hydride (NiMH) batteries and hold a charge for much longer. They also have a greater temperature tolerance and are less susceptible to corrosion. They are also lightweight which makes them easy to carry and handle. Easy to store A roadworthy mobility scoot allows you to travel to places that are otherwise difficult to access like local parks, shops or even the beach. You can also take your mobility scooter with you on holidays and cruises by choosing a travel-friendly model that folds down into several small pieces that are easy to manage. It is easy to fit your mobility scooter inside the trunk without needing to hire a big vehicle or ask a companion to lift it up. The most reliable travel scooters have frames that are small and a battery that can be removed to allow off-board charging, meaning they can be disassembled in under one minute to fit into the boot of your car, or a small vehicle such as the hatchback. When shopping, make sure to look for this type of specification as well as the heaviest item's weight, to ensure you are able to manage the weight of the entire unit. It doesn't matter if you pick a lightweight folding scooter or one that breaks down into several parts they all have lower turning radiuses than bariatric or standard models, making them ideal for tight spaces like doorways in your home. They also have a smaller profile than wheelchairs, which allows them to be put in the corner of the room or even in the back of your car.
